Lee, You cannot run a .bat file on a Linux machine. That's a Windows-specific scripting technology. What about trying a shell or perl script instead? - Ian ________________________________ From: condor-users-bounces@xxxxxxxxxxx [mailto:condor-users-bounces@xxxxxxxxxxx] On Behalf Of Gooding, Stephen L Sent: February 14, 2005 11:19 AM To: condor-users@xxxxxxxxxxx Subject: [Condor-users] condor_exec.exe on linux machine?
